Redis脑裂问题

背景 假设现在有三台机器,分别安装了redis服务,结构如图 故障发生:如果此时master服务器所在区域网络通信出现异常,导致和两台slave机器无法正常通信,但是和客户端的连接是正常的。那么sentinel就会从两台slave机器中选举其中一个作为新的master来处理客户端请求。如图 这个时候,已经存在两台master服务器,client发送的数据会持续保存在旧的master服务器中,而新的
相关文章
相关标签/搜索